Out-of-school rate for adolescents of lower secondary school age in Nigeria
Nigeria: Out-of-school rate for adolescents of lower secondary school age was 23.2% in 2025. ▲ Rising
Out-of-school rate for adolescents of lower secondary school age in Nigeria, 2000–2025
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2025, out-of-school rate for adolescents of lower secondary school age in Nigeria stood at 23.2%.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 5.3% on the previous year and down 12.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, out-of-school rate for adolescents of lower secondary school age in Nigeria peaked at 26.4% in 2015 and was at its lowest, 19.5%, in 2006.
That places Nigeria 48th out of 206 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.
Out-of-school rate for adolescents of lower secondary school age in Nigeria,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 26.1% | — |
| 2001 | 24.3% | -6.9% |
| 2002 | 22.7% | -6.6% |
| 2003 | 21.1% | -7.0% |
| 2004 | 20.2% | -4.3% |
| 2005 | 19.7% | -2.5% |
| 2006 | 19.5% | -1.0% |
| 2007 | 19.7% | +1.0% |
| 2008 | 20.0% | +1.5% |
| 2009 | 21.0% | +5.0% |
| 2010 | 22.5% | +7.1% |
| 2011 | 24.1% | +7.1% |
| 2012 | 25.0% | +3.7% |
| 2013 | 25.5% | +2.0% |
| 2014 | 25.9% | +1.6% |
| 2015 | 26.4% | +1.9% |
| 2016 | 26.1% | -1.1% |
| 2017 | 25.6% | -1.9% |
| 2018 | 25.6% | +0.0% |
| 2019 | 25.8% | +0.8% |
| 2020 | 26.2% | +1.6% |
| 2021 | 26.0% | -0.8% |
| 2022 | 26.1% | +0.4% |
| 2023 | 25.7% | -1.5% |
| 2024 | 24.5% | -4.7% |
| 2025 | 23.2% | -5.3% |
